Beach Bili is a serene and captivating beach located in Lovište, on the Pelješac Peninsula in Croatia's Dubrovnik-Neretva County. This beach is characterized by its natural beauty, offering a tranquil ambiance far from bustling crowds. It stretches along a scenic coastline, where soft golden sand meets the clear waters of the Adriatic Sea, making it an ideal spot for visitors seeking peace and relaxation. The beach's setting amidst lush Mediterranean greenery creates an inviting atmosphere perfect for unwinding and enjoying the pristine environment.
Renowned for its unspoiled charm, Beach Bili provides a quiet retreat with spectacular views of the sea and surrounding landscapes. Lovište itself is a quaint fishing village, adding to the authentic experience with its peaceful vibe and traditional Croatian coastal culture. Visitors can enjoy long, sunny days here, thanks to the area’s Mediterranean climate that offers over 3000 hours of sunshine annually, making it a favored destination for sun seekers and nature lovers alike.
While the beach is not equipped with extensive commercial facilities, its natural allure and calm waters make it attractive for those who appreciate understated beauty. The absence of large crowds and family-oriented amenities further enhances its appeal as an escape into nature, complemented by nearby hiking trails and historic landmarks such as the Lovište Lighthouse.
